Elderly bathroom remodeling services focus on creating safer, more accessible, and comfortable bathrooms for seniors and individuals with mobility challenges. These remodeling projects often involve installing grab bars, non-slip flooring, walk-in showers, and higher or adjustable countertops to reduce the risk of falls and make daily routines easier. Service providers can also add features such as seat benches, handheld showerheads, and lowered fixtures to accommodate specific needs. The goal is to transform existing bathrooms into functional spaces that promote independence and safety without sacrificing style or convenience.

Many common problems that prompt elderly bathroom remodeling include difficulty stepping over high tub sides, trouble maintaining balance on slippery surfaces, and challenges reaching or using standard fixtures. Older bathrooms may have narrow doorways, inadequate lighting, or cluttered layouts that increase hazards. Remodeling can address these issues by widening doorways, improving lighting, and reconfiguring layouts to allow easier movement. These updates help reduce accidents and make the bathroom a more secure environment for seniors, caregivers, and family members who assist with daily routines.

The overview below groups typical Elderly Bathroom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Taylor,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ine bathroom modifications, such as grab bar installation or minor fixture updates, typically range from $250-$600. These projects are common and usually fall within the lower to middle end of the cost spectrum.

Surface Renovations - Upgrading surfaces like tiles, flooring, or repainting gener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ects stay within this range, with fewer reaching higher due to added complexity.

Full Bathroom Remodels - Complete renovations that include new fixtures, cabinetry, and accessibility features often range from $5,000 to $15,000. Larger, more detailed projects can exceed this range depending on scope and materials.

Major Remodels and Custom Builds - Extensive overhauls involving structural changes or high-end finishes can cost $20,000 or more. These projects are less common and tend to be at the upper end of the typical cost spectrum for local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
